PCProductions wrote:Derozan looks completely helpless with Lebron on him. Just cannot play his game against Lebron's strength.



Guys like Carmelo and Pierce and Derozan who rely on their mid range game and trying to body guys just play right into Lebron's hands. They pump fake and try to get an angle and end up bouncing off Lebron's body way off balance. He just gives a small cushion while they can't drive past him and with his athleticism it's a super strong contest.
